周桂初 ,程新文,李英成,柳忠偉,李英杰
(1.中國地質(zhì)大學(xué)(武漢),湖北 武漢 430074;2.中國測繪科學(xué)研究院,北京 100039)
基于寬巷載波的GPS周跳探測與修復(fù)的算法改進(jìn)
周桂初1,程新文1,李英成2,柳忠偉1,李英杰2
(1.中國地質(zhì)大學(xué)(武漢),湖北 武漢 430074;2.中國測繪科學(xué)研究院,北京 100039)
鑒于雙頻P碼偽距結(jié)合相位觀測值用于探測周跳存在的不足,提出了結(jié)合DCPC圖像和相應(yīng)的算法來分析周跳發(fā)生大小以及發(fā)生位置的方法。尤其是在載波L1與L2出現(xiàn)大小相同的周跳且寬巷載波失效的情況下,需結(jié)合DCPC圖像來分析周跳發(fā)生的歷元,通過M-W寬巷載波組合及其電離層殘差組合,用兩歷元間的二元一次方程來修復(fù)周跳。該方法能夠快速地探測及修復(fù)周跳,具有實(shí)用性。
M-W寬巷組合;DCPC圖像;L1載波;L2載波;多項(xiàng)式擬合;電離層殘差組合
目前對周跳探測及修復(fù)的方法有:高次差法[1]、多項(xiàng)式擬合法、偽距相位組合法、電離層殘差法和小波法,各方法都有其優(yōu)缺點(diǎn)。例如,高次差法主要用于較大周跳的探測和修復(fù);而多項(xiàng)式擬合法隨著時(shí)間序列的遞增,加上誤差的累積, 擬合值與實(shí)際觀測值之差將越來越大,甚至發(fā)散,導(dǎo)致無法進(jìn)行周跳探測和修復(fù);小波法一般需要2個(gè)以及2個(gè)以上測站求雙差觀測量[2]。由于利用L1和L2雙頻觀測值的寬巷組合可以消除站星幾何距離及電離層的影響,并且適合動(dòng)態(tài)情形的周跳探測與修復(fù)。因此,本文將用雙頻P碼偽距結(jié)合相位觀測值 (M-W寬巷組合) 來探測、修復(fù)周跳,并結(jié)合相位減偽距法探明周跳是在L1觀測值還是在L2觀測值產(chǎn)生的。此方法比較簡單,計(jì)算效率高,有很強(qiáng)的實(shí)用性。
P碼偽距測量的觀測方程式為:
載波相位測量的觀測方程式為:
由雙頻的偽距與相位觀測值求差得:
將雙頻相位觀測值相減得:
由式(5)可以看出,M-W組合不僅消除了電離層延遲,同時(shí)消除了站星間的幾何距離以及衛(wèi)星鐘差與接收機(jī)鐘差。所構(gòu)造的周跳檢測量與接收機(jī)的運(yùn)動(dòng)沒有直接聯(lián)系,僅受多路徑誤差以及測量噪聲的影響,但可以通過多個(gè)歷元的觀測來平滑減弱或者消除。因此,即使存在軌道誤差、站坐標(biāo)誤差和大氣延遲誤差,也可以通過M-W組合來確定觀測值的整周模糊度,同時(shí)又能確定寬巷組合中的周跳大小。
任意歷元寬巷觀測值的整周模糊度NM-W的解可以由式(5)求得。在沒有周跳發(fā)生的情況下,NM-W的組合在連續(xù)歷元出現(xiàn)微小的不規(guī)則運(yùn)動(dòng),主要是由偽距的多路徑誤差和觀測噪聲引起。當(dāng)其中連續(xù)歷元發(fā)生了周跳,且滿足一定條件下,可以通過NM-W的組合在連續(xù)歷元之間發(fā)生的變化來發(fā)現(xiàn)[3]。
求得寬巷觀測值的整周跳變后,需要進(jìn)一步確定周跳究竟是由L1觀測值還是L2觀測值引起的。當(dāng)L1觀測值與L2觀測值中產(chǎn)生同樣大小的周跳時(shí),此方法失效。
雖然可以直接采用多項(xiàng)式擬合分別對L1相位載波及其L2相位載波的前i+1歷元進(jìn)行擬合,求出i+2個(gè)歷元的整周模糊度,但是計(jì)算量特別大,無法計(jì)算出較小的周跳,并且周跳只發(fā)生在其中1個(gè)頻率上,此方法顯得累贅[3]。
單頻率的P碼偽距觀測值方程表達(dá)式為:
式中,ρ(t)為幾何距離;Vion為電離層延遲;Vtrop為對流層延遲;VTR為接收機(jī)鐘差;εP為觀測噪聲;VTS為衛(wèi)星鐘差,可以通過導(dǎo)航電文改正。
單頻率載波相位的觀測值方程表達(dá)式為:
與式(9)比較,新增1個(gè)未知數(shù)整周模糊度N??紤]到連續(xù)2周歷元間周跳大小一樣,因此取連續(xù)第i+1與第i+2個(gè)歷元,分別求取偽距觀測值之差以及載波相位觀測值之差,即
由于DCPC受電離層及其對流層的殘差等影響,在連續(xù)的一段歷元,其值有微小變化。但是當(dāng)在第i+1個(gè)歷元與第i+2歷元出現(xiàn)周跳時(shí),則DCPC值突然變大,且在第i+2個(gè)歷元與第i+3個(gè)歷元的DCPC值突然變小,表明第i+2歷元出現(xiàn)周跳[4],如圖1所示。
圖1 DCPC隨連續(xù)時(shí)間序列的變化
1.3 3 三種方式結(jié)合求解周跳原理
雖然通過M-W寬巷組合能探測出周跳,但是無法確定周跳產(chǎn)生的具體位置及其大小。盡管對λ1ΔN1-λ2ΔN2=a0+a1t+a2t2的前i+1個(gè)無周跳歷元進(jìn)行多項(xiàng)式擬合,并結(jié)合ΔN1-ΔN2=ΔNM-W能計(jì)算出周跳產(chǎn)生的位置及其大小,但是,如果周跳只發(fā)生在其中一個(gè)載波上,只是無法確定發(fā)生的位置,那么采用多項(xiàng)式擬合計(jì)算顯得累贅,并且影響周跳的大小,特別是較小周跳數(shù)。
因此,采用M-W寬巷載波組合、單頻率偽距及相位雙差求解周跳顯得更加便捷,并能用于快速實(shí)時(shí)動(dòng)態(tài)定位的周跳探測及其修復(fù)。
反之,如果載波L1的DCPC1圖像在第i+1個(gè)歷元沒發(fā)生突變,而載波L2的DCPC2圖像在第i+1個(gè)歷元發(fā)生突變,則說明該周跳發(fā)生在載波L2上,其周跳值為:
2)同上述條件一樣,明確在第i+1個(gè)歷元發(fā)生周跳,且在載波L1的DCPC1圖像與載波L2的DCPC2圖像在第i+1個(gè)歷元都發(fā)生突變,于是結(jié)合式(17),可以求解出載波L1和載波L2上的周跳大小。
因此,為了求得載波L1與載波L2發(fā)生周跳的大小,可以通過M-W寬巷載波組合與其電離層殘差組合結(jié)合來獲得。兩歷元間差的二元一次方程為:
本文利用的數(shù)據(jù)是2011-03-24由Ashtech接收機(jī)采集的數(shù)據(jù),采樣率是1 s,衛(wèi)星星號(hào)PRN7。截取14:00時(shí)間段的30個(gè)歷元,為了驗(yàn)證3種情況下探測和修復(fù)周跳的能力,需要考慮3種情況的周跳圖與測試情況及其改正結(jié)果。
圖2 L1或L2周跳的相關(guān)參數(shù)變化
結(jié)合圖3載波L1的DCPC1圖像與載波L2的DCPC1圖像判斷周跳在第15個(gè)歷元,其跳變值最大的為周跳發(fā)生的位置。通過L1及L2載波DCPC圖像比較,其載波L1的DCPC1圖像在第15個(gè)歷元有明顯跳變,雖然載波L2的DCPC2圖像在第15個(gè)歷元也有微小跳變,但是其振幅未超過其閾值, 主要由于電離層殘余差等引起,因?yàn)榭纱_定周跳發(fā)生在L1載波上,其運(yùn)算的結(jié)果為:
圖3 L1、L2 載波DCPC圖像
2)L1、L2不同大小周跳的探測及其修復(fù)。若在L1上加5個(gè)周跳,L2上加3個(gè)周跳。如圖4所示,L1、L2的2個(gè)參數(shù)在第15個(gè)歷元處有明顯變化,通過圖5載波L1的DCPC1圖像與載波L2的DCPC2圖像發(fā)現(xiàn),在第15個(gè)歷元都有明顯的跳變,那么周跳探測正確。其運(yùn)算結(jié)果為:ΔN1=4.919 7≈5周,ΔN2=2.775 8≈3周,計(jì)算結(jié)果與模擬值相符。
圖4 L1、L2載波的相關(guān)參數(shù)變化
圖5 L1、L2 DCPC圖像
3)L1、L2相同大小周跳的探測及其修復(fù)。若在L1、L2上分別加上5個(gè)周跳,L1、L2的2個(gè)參數(shù)在所有的歷元的變化相似。但是通過載波L1的DCPC1圖像與載波L2的DCPC2圖像發(fā)現(xiàn),在第15個(gè)歷元開始有明顯跳變。通過M-W寬巷載波組合及其電離層殘差組合,運(yùn)算結(jié)果為:ΔN1=4.721 7≈5周,ΔN2=4.749 7≈5周,計(jì)算結(jié)果與模擬值相符,周跳修復(fù)成功。由于與圖2的載波L1的參數(shù)相近,故參數(shù)圖略,僅僅給出L1、L2載波的DCPC圖像,如圖6所示。
圖6 L1、L2 DCPC圖像
1)通過M-W寬巷載波明確周跳發(fā)生的歷元,但是不知道周跳發(fā)生的位置時(shí),要分析DCPC圖形。若只有其中的1個(gè)載波的DCPC圖形發(fā)生突變,那么結(jié)合M-W寬巷載波可以直接探測及修復(fù)周跳的大?。蝗?個(gè)載波的DCPC圖形在該歷元發(fā)生突變,需要結(jié)合M-W寬巷載波及其多項(xiàng)式擬合來探測周跳的大小。
2)當(dāng)發(fā)生的周跳大小相等時(shí),M-W寬巷載波方法失效。但是,DCPC圖形在某歷元發(fā)生突變,可將M-W寬巷載波組合與電離層殘差組合結(jié)合兩歷元間差的二元一次方程來修復(fù)周跳。
3)本文提出的方法不但提高了周跳修復(fù)能力,而且組合簡單,計(jì)算效率高,但其仍然無法修復(fù)小的周跳。另外,DCPC圖形對于小周跳的突變不容易判斷。
[1] 黃愛萱,吳云,黃小華. 利用GPS組合觀測值探測修復(fù)周跳的方法比較[J].測繪工程,2009,16(4):25-29
[2] 劉超,王堅(jiān),許長輝. 一種雙頻數(shù)據(jù)的周跳探測和修復(fù)方法研究[J]. 海洋測繪,2009,29(6):9-14
[3] 廖向前,黃順吉.GPS載波相位的周跳檢測方法[J].電子科技大學(xué)學(xué)報(bào),1997,26(6): 23-28
[4] 王新洲,花向紅,邱蕾.GPS變形監(jiān)測中整周模糊度解算的新方法[J].武漢大學(xué)學(xué)報(bào):信息科學(xué)版,2007,32(1): 10-15
[5] 李征航. GPS測量與數(shù)據(jù)處理[M]. 武漢:武漢大學(xué)出版社,2005
[6] 劉基余. GPS衛(wèi)星導(dǎo)航定位原理與方法[M]. 北京:科學(xué)出版社,2009
[7] 生人軍. GPS載波相位定位中周跳探測方法的研究[EB/OL].2007-04http://www.chkinet/KCMS/deitail/
[8] 王仁謙. 用TURBOEALIT方法對GPS觀測數(shù)據(jù)進(jìn)行周跳探測[J].鐵道勘測,2010,27(5): 13-17
Algorithm Improvement of Detecting and Repairing of GPS Slips Based on Wide Lane Carrier
byZHOU Guichu
This paper put forward that DCPC image would detect where the slips happened, and combine with a polynomial fitting to repair slips. Especially when L1 carrier and L2 carrier own the same size weeks, DCPC image can analysis the epoch which the same slips occur on. At the last, the M-W wide lane carrier combination and the ionosphere residual combined with two epoch difference of an equation can repair the slips. According to experiments analysis, the method is proven to be able to quickly detect weeks and repair jump, and is more practical.
M-W wide lane combination,DCPC image,L1 carrier,L2 carrier, polynomial fitting method,ionosphere residual combination
P228.41
B
1672-4623(2013)02-0118-04
10.11709/j.issn.1672-4623.2013.02.038
2012-12-06。
項(xiàng)目來源:國家科技支撐計(jì)劃資助項(xiàng)目(YK1206-SR1)。
周桂初,碩士,主要從事GPS導(dǎo)航應(yīng)用研究。